Menghubungkan ke instans RDS Custom DB Anda menggunakan AWS Systems Manager - Layanan Basis Data Relasional Amazon

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Menghubungkan ke instans RDS Custom DB Anda menggunakan AWS Systems Manager

Setelah membuat instans RDS Custom DB, Anda dapat menghubungkannya menggunakan AWS Systems Manager Session Manager. Session Manager adalah kemampuan Systems Manager yang dapat Anda gunakan untuk mengelola EC2 instans Amazon melalui shell berbasis browser atau melalui file. AWS CLI Untuk informasi selengkapnya, lihat AWS Systems Manager Session Manager.

Cara terhubung ke instans DB Anda menggunakan Session Manager
  1. Masuk ke AWS Management Console dan buka RDS konsol Amazon di https://console.aws.amazon.com/rds/.

  2. Di panel navigasi, pilih Databases, lalu pilih instans RDS Custom DB yang ingin Anda sambungkan.

  3. Pilih Konfigurasi.

  4. Catat nilai ID Sumber Daya untuk instans DB Anda. Misalnya, ID sumber daya mungkin db-ABCDEFGHIJKLMNOPQRS0123456.

  5. Buka EC2 konsol Amazon di https://console.aws.amazon.com/ec2/.

  6. Di panel navigasi, pilih Instans.

  7. Cari nama EC2 instance Anda, lalu pilih ID instance yang terkait dengannya. Misalnya, ID instans mungkin i-abcdefghijklm01234.

  8. Pilih Hubungkan.

  9. Pilih Session Manager.

  10. Pilih Hubungkan.

    Sebuah jendela terbuka untuk sesi Anda.

Anda dapat terhubung ke instans RDS Custom DB Anda menggunakan file AWS CLI. Teknik ini membutuhkan plugin Session Manager untuk AWS CLI. Untuk mempelajari cara menginstal plugin, lihat Instal plugin Session Manager untuk AWS CLI.

Untuk menemukan ID sumber daya DB dari instans RDS Custom DB Anda, gunakandescribe-db-instances.

aws rds describe-db-instances \ --query 'DBInstances[*].[DBInstanceIdentifier,DbiResourceId]' \ --output text

Output sampel berikut menunjukkan ID sumber daya untuk instance RDS Kustom Anda. Prefiksnya adalah db-.

db-ABCDEFGHIJKLMNOPQRS0123456

Untuk menemukan ID EC2 instans dari instans DB Anda, gunakanaws ec2 describe-instances. Contoh berikut menggunakan db-ABCDEFGHIJKLMNOPQRS0123456 untuk ID sumber daya.

aws ec2 describe-instances \ --filters "Name=tag:Name,Values=db-ABCDEFGHIJKLMNOPQRS0123456" \ --output text \ --query 'Reservations[*].Instances[*].InstanceId'

Output sampel berikut menunjukkan ID EC2 instance.

i-abcdefghijklm01234

Gunakan aws ssm start-session perintah, memasok ID EC2 instance dalam --target parameter.

aws ssm start-session --target "i-abcdefghijklm01234"

Koneksi yang berhasil terlihat seperti berikut.

Starting session with SessionId: yourid-abcdefghijklm1234 [ssm-user@ip-123-45-67-89 bin]$